NHL sources say the Edmonton Oilers are pushing hard to move out bodies, but Oilers gm, Steve Tambellini hasn't reached a point of desparation where he's willing to sweeten the pot to make a deal.
For example, the Maple Leafs would likely move either Exelby or Stempniak for Oilers captain Ethan Moreau, if Edmonton throws in a draft pick to soothe the pain of swallowing Moreau's contract which includes another year at $1.75 million and a $2 million cap hit.
Darren Dreger, on Steve Tambellini and his continued dithering.
